SFASU is located in Nacogdoches, Texas and has a total student population of 12,620. Of the 2,435 students who graduated with a bachelor’s degree from Stephen F Austin State University in 2021, 56 of them were social sciences majors.

Of the 56 students who earned a bachelor's degree in Social Sciences from SFASU in 2020-2021, 61% were men and 39% were women. The typical social sciences bachelor's degree program is made up of only 44% men. So male students are more repesented at SFASU since its program graduates 17% more men than average.

undefined

About 70% of those who receive a bachelor's degree in social sciences at SFASU are white. This is above average for this degree on the nationwide level.
